Post Production
Post production refers to the work done after filming or creating the first part of a media text. For example, when a film is being made (i,e filmed and direcdted) it is known as the production. Therefore the effects and editing added after is known as the post production. Almost all media text is produced with post production in mind.
"The stages of film production happening between the actual filming and the completed film
Using Media Convention
There are many conventions in media which are, and are not always followed. Just because they are conventions, it does not mean that they are compulsory and must be followed; however if they are conventions, they must be so for a reason and they must be doing something right in order for the media industry to be growing strong at the current stage. Some forms of media conventions in a magazine for example is the 'masthead', main image and side articles.
Relation to real world texts
Many ideas for films and stories come from real past or present events that have occurred in the world. Great examples of this include films that have been made after the tragic 9/11 attacks. Films were created to portray different points of views and different ways of telling the story. Films based on real world texts can often be the most interesting as people are interested as to see how the event had occurred and what really happened. This cannot be mistaken for a documentary however as films may not always tell the truth. "Never let the truth get in the way of a good story".
